Samsung Galaxy S20 5G SM-G981UZAAXAA Cosmic Gray 128GB
Why we recommend this ▼
The Snapdragon 865 processor with 12GB of RAM powers a smooth 120Hz display and 1300 nits peak brightness for sharp outdoor visibility. Its 64MP triple-camera system captures 8K video and Single Take AI automatically generates multiple image styles from one shutter press, while IP68 water resistance and expandable storage add durability. This phone is best for content creators who need all-day 4000mAh battery life to consistently capture 30x zoom telephoto shots and high-resolution video.
Samsung Galaxy A A366E/DS Awesome Black 256GB
Why we recommend this ▼
Its 6.7-inch Super AMOLED 120Hz display (1,200 nits), Snapdragon 6 Gen 3 chip, and 5,000mAh battery enabling 29-hour video playback deliver smooth, bright performance. IP67 water resistance, stereo speakers, and a six-generation Android upgrade policy add durability and future-proofing uncommon at this tier. Best for media consumers and upgraders seeking a reliable, long-lasting 5G phone with a vivid display and no-nonsense battery life for all-day streaming and web browsing.
Samsung Galaxy S21 Ultra Phantom Black 128GB
Why we recommend this ▼
The 108MP main camera with 3x and 10x optical telephoto lenses enables 100x Space Zoom and 8K video, powered by a Snapdragon 888 chip. Its 6.8-inch 120Hz Dynamic AMOLED display at 3200x1440 resolution pairs with a 5000mAh battery for all-day sessions. This phone suits mobile photography enthusiasts who need extreme telephoto reach, high-resolution cropping, and 8K capture in a water-resistant body.
Samsung Galaxy A26 SM-A266M/DS Mint 256GB
Why we recommend this ▼
A 6.7-inch Super AMOLED 120Hz display and a 5000mAh battery with IP67 water resistance make this a durable daily driver, while the 50MP main camera includes OIS for steady shots. Its budget-friendly price and strong battery life score (76.2/100) are complemented by expandable storage and 5G connectivity. Best for users seeking a reliable, water-resistant phone with long battery life and a smooth display, but not for mobile gamers due to its weaker gaming performance.

Samsung Galaxy S22 SM-S901UZKAXAA Phantom Black 128GB
Why we recommend this ▼
Armed with a Snapdragon octa-core processor up to 2.99GHz and a versatile 50MP triple-lens camera with 3x optical zoom, this 6.1-inch Dynamic AMOLED phone packs flagship imaging into a 168g IP68-rated body. Stereo speakers and 8K video recording complement its pocketable form, setting it apart in a market of oversized flagships. It suits photography enthusiasts and compact-phone loyalists, though its gaming score of 38.8 means it’s not ideal for intensive mobile gaming.
